About Ben Hill County
Ben Hill County is a low-population county of about 17,089 residents in Georgia. Its public-school system enrolls approximately 2,910 students across 5 schools.
Looking at the broader picture, census numbers show median household income runs near $41,758, 13%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ate is around 20%. That income level is 33% noticeably below the Georgia median.
On the school-mix side, Ben Hill County spans 2 elementary schools (1,367 students), 1 middle school (594), and 2 high schools (949).
Ben Hill County Public Schools is the biggest district by enrollment, covering about 2,910 students across Ben Hill County.
Trend over the past 7 years. Across the same 7-year window, public-school enrollment decreased 11%: 3,175 students in SY 2017-18 versus 2,831 in SY 2024-25.
